Программирование в 1С 8.3 с нуля — краткий самоучитель

Даже если вы заранее изучали другие языки программирования, например, C++, PHP, Java, стоит помнить, что 1С хоть и во многом сходе, но все-таки имеет много принципиальных различий.

Сразу начнем с рекомендации самоучителя по программированию в 1С 8.3 от «Школы 1С» на Youtube, а затем рассмотрим существующие книги и видео уровки.

С чего начать с нуля?

Самое главное в 1С – то, что не нужно придумывать свои виды объектов. Все они уже есть в конфигурации.

Установите технологическую платформу 1С себе на компьютер, и откройте в конфигураторе новую или уже существующую базу. Для начала можно использовать абсолютно бесплатную учебную версию 1С 8.3 для обучения программированию.

Наша команда предоставляет услуги по консультированию, настройке и внедрению 1С.
Связаться с нами можно по телефону +7 499 350 29 00.
Услуги и цены можно увидеть по ссылке.
Будем рады помочь Вам!

В левой части окна вы увидите дерево объектов конфигурации. К ним относятся документы, справочники, регистры, бизнес-процессы и многое другое.

Данные так же хранятся в СУБД, но разработчик обычно не работает с ними напрямую. При помощи технологической платформы программист обращается уже к объектам конфигурации или информационной базы.

В 1С, как и во многих других языках программирования, очень часто используются запросы. Язык запросов в 1С схож с языком T-SQL. Запросы можно писать как на английском, так и на русском, в прочем, как и остальной код.

Вроде бы все просто, но для работы «в полевых условиях» одного знания языка программирования чаще всего не достаточно. Дело в том, что в большинстве организаций, использующих 1С, установлены типовые конфигурации, и их нужно знать.

Получите понятные самоучители по 1С бесплатно:

Рекомендуется изучить самые распространенные конфигурации. К ним относятся такие, как «Бухгалтерия» и «Управление торговлей». Так же часто используются «ЗУП» и «Розница».

коробки 1с

В плане работы для 1С программистов существуют две основные ветви: франчайзи или работа «на себя» и работа в качестве штатного программиста it-отдела какой-либо организации. Данный выбор зависит только от ваших предпочтений.

При работе в франчайзи, на фрилансе или ведении собственного бизнеса оплата будет сдельная. Работы может быть много и нужно выкладываться по-полной. Верхней планки по заработной плате здесь нет, и вы можете заработать внушительную сумму денег.

Если вы решите работать на фрилансе, либо открыть собственный бизнес, не нужно будет ни с кем «делиться» своим заработком (кроме государства и фрилансовой площадки естественно). Но в таком случае и клиентов будет необходимо искать самостоятельно.

Если вы все же решили устроиться в организацию в качестве штатного программиста, то будете мало зависеть т объема выполненной работы. В данном случае есть некая стабильность, но и зарплатная планка ограничена.

Конечно же, эти два способа можно совместить, работая штатным программистом днем и на фрилансе по вечерам.

Что хорошо у 1С программистов, так это то, что у вас может не быть технического образование (например, вы экономист, бухгалтер и т. п.). Для подтверждения своих знаний перед клиентами или работодателем вы можете предоставить свои сертификаты 1С.

Сертификаты бывают различных видов, как по платформе (для программистов), так и по типовым решениям. Получить их можно в фирме 1С, сдав экзамен в виде теста или практического задания.

сертификаты 1С

Книги по 1С

Лучше всего изучать 1С по книгам, которые были изданы фирмой 1С. Так сказать, от первоисточника. Некоторые из них идут с поставками типовых конфигураций. Так же вы можете купить отдельные книги.

Книга «1С:Программирование для начинающих» предназначена для людей, далеких от программирования, но желающих научиться создавать собственные решения на 1С 8.3 с самого нуля.

хеллоу 1С

«Hello, 1C» показывает самые простые, основные возможности разработки прикладных решений в системе 1С:Предприятие 8.

В «101 совете» описаны различные способы решения одних и тех же задач.

практическое пособие разработчика

Практическое пособие разработчика 1С Предприятие 8.3 — очень подробное пособие, описывающее приемы разработки с простыми и понятными примерами. Данная книга одна из самых лучших для изучения 1С программирования.

язык запросов 1С 8

В данном пособии описывается язык запросов с нуля для тех, кто не знаком даже с SQL.

разработка сложных отчетов на СКД

Настоятельно советуем книгу «Разработка сложных отчетов в 1С:Предприятие 8» для углубленного изучения СКД. Зачастую даже на форумах по 1С людям, спрашивающим совет по решению проблем с отчетами, рекомендуют именно ее.

реализация прикладных задач в 1с

Данная книга даст вам более углубленные знания 1С в качестве разработчика.

разработка управляемого приложения

Если ранее вы занимались разработкой на 1С, но на обычных формах, советуем эту книгу. В ней вы получите много знаний по новому управляемому интерфейсу.

Так же много полезной информации, как по программированию, так и по работе с типовыми решениями вы можете узнать из наших статей по программированию.

Видеокурсы и уроки по 1С

Кроме книг мы рекомендуем просматривать видео-уроки для большей наглядности. На ютубе много каналов, посвященных программированию 1С с нуля, например:

 

Поделиться

Оцените статью

1 Звезда2 Звезды3 Звезды4 Звезды5 Звезд
Загрузка...

Подпишитесь на наш YouTube канал

YouTube

Подписаться

Комментировать

Комментарии

  1. Надежда(Hope)

    «Запросы можно писать как на английском, так и на русском, в прочем, как и остальной код.»
    То есть можно как то на английском программировать в 1С???

    2
    5
    • Prospero2005

      Подразумевается, что каждому русскоязычному оператору/функции/процедуре есть англоязычный аналог в синтаксисе (к примеру Если / If , ИначеЕсли /ElseIf и т.д.

      8
      3
    • Andrew

      Нужно)

      5
      6
      • Алексей

        Не умничайте.

        • AlexSC

          Люди, очнитесь, как можно прграммированить на русском, тем более в 1С, это Excel в обертке

          10
          7
          • kollos1986

            Если вы не смогли, это не значит что другие не смогут. А если не пробовали, то и вообще не мешайтесь с глупыми рекомендациями.

            10
            6
          • A1

            на Excel тоже можно многое, только то что вы этого не знаете не означает что в нем нет различных функций

            4
            7
          • Оглоед

            Мнение дилетанта

            5
            3
          • geo

            Если вы увидели табличку, это не означает, что это Excel, если вы не понимаете данное: «Данные так же хранятся в СУБД, но разработчик обычно не работает с ними напрямую. При помощи технологической платформы программист обращается уже к объектам конфигурации или информационной базы» — зачем вы пишете такую шнягу???

            5
            4
          • Ремденок Сергей Павлович

            Как то раз летним днём приехал я в Хабаровск ходил гулял все город веселил как то я пришёл в организации ооо Юнитком Плюс там меня любезно встретил Малахов А.Н. Помог мне пройти обучение и сдав все экзамены он смог подобрать мне хорошую достойную работу с большим количеством хороших людей работал я пол года на флоте приехал сходил к гражданину Малахову отблагодарил я его как положено сейчас работаю в хорошей компании с хорошим заработком

            4
            3
          • Кеша

            Скорее это глубоко модернизированный Access.

            2
            6
    • Сисадмин

      Да, можно

      3
      7
    • Кеша

      На каждую команду в SQL и VB есть альяс на русском

  2. Умарали

    АССАЛОМУ АЛАЙКУМ

    11
    9
  3. Анна

    У Вас ошибка в тексте в самом начале текста — «сходе», та наверное должно быть схоже.

    4
    3
  4. Анна

    Ребят, проверьте текст на ошибки! Зависеть мало «т», пропущена буква «о». «Технического образование» по смыслу текста окончание должно быть «образования».

    3
    5